The Importance of Hydration and Nutrition

Following a long bike ride, the body loses significant fluids and electrolytes. Prompt rehydration is essential to restore optimal physiological function. Water is vital, but incorporating electrolytes can further enhance recovery. Sports drinks often contain a balanced mix of sodium and potassium, which helps prevent cramping and aids in fluid absorption.

In addition to hydration, nutrition plays a critical role in recovery. Consuming a meal rich in vitamins and minerals will support metabolic processes. Timing is crucial; experts suggest eating a meal or snack within 30 minutes post-ride to jumpstart recovery.

Protein and Carbohydrates for Muscle Repair

Muscle recovery relies heavily on the intake of protein and carbohydrates. Protein aids in repairing muscle tissue breakdown that occurs during intense exercise. Aim for 20-30 grams of high-quality protein post-ride, such as lean meats, dairy, or plant-based options.

Carbohydrates are equally important for replenishing glycogen stores, which can become depleted after strenuous activity. Combining protein and carbohydrates improves recovery efficiency. A common recommendation is a 3:1 ratio of carbohydrates to protein. For example, a banana with a scoop of yogurt can provide an ideal balance for recovery.

Recovery Drinks and Glycogen Replenishment

Recovery drinks offer a convenient solution for quick nourishment after a long ride. These drinks often contain the necessary carbohydrates and protein to enhance recovery. They should ideally include both simple sugars for rapid glycogen replenishment and complex carbohydrates for sustained energy.

When selecting a recovery drink, check for a blend of electrolytes to assist with rehydration and overall recovery. This combination supports muscle repair and restores performance levels. Many athletes find it beneficial to incorporate such drinks into their post-ride routine to maximise the recovery process effectively.

The Role of Sleep in Recovery

Quality sleep is vital for effective recovery following intense physical activity. During sleep, the body engages in processes that repair muscles and tissues. The growth hormone, which plays a significant role in tissue growth and repair, is released primarily during deep sleep.

Aim for 7-9 hours of uninterrupted sleep per night. Creating a conducive sleep environment can enhance quality. This includes maintaining a cool, dark room and minimising noise. Establishing a pre-sleep routine, such as winding down with a book or meditation, can signal the body that it’s time to rest.

Massage and Foam Rolling for Soreness

Massage therapy is a beneficial recovery technique that aids in reducing muscle soreness. It increases blood flow to the muscles, which helps in delivering the nutrients necessary for recovery. Regular sessions can help alleviate tension and improve overall muscle function.

Foam rolling is a self-massage technique that anyone can perform. It aids in breaking down fascia and promoting blood circulation. Focus on areas that feel tight or sore, rolling slowly for 30 seconds to 1 minute on each muscle group. Both methods help decrease recovery time and enhance performance in subsequent rides.

Stretching and Flexibility Work

Incorporating stretching into a post-ride routine helps maintain and improve flexibility. Flexibility can prevent injuries and enhance performance in future rides. Target major muscle groups like the hamstrings, quadriceps, and calves, holding each stretch for 15-30 seconds.

Dynamic stretching before rides prepares the muscles for activity, while static stretching after can help relax them. Practices like yoga can also be beneficial, promoting both flexibility and mental recovery. The combination of these techniques aids in soothing muscle soreness and improving range of motion.

Active Recovery and Rest Days

Active recovery and scheduled rest are crucial components of an effective training plan. Practising gentle activities helps alleviate muscle soreness, while rest days allow for proper recovery and adaptation, reducing the risk of overtraining.

Incorporating Gentle Stretching and Recovery Rides

Gentle stretching promotes flexibility and aids in muscle recovery post-ride. Activities such as yoga or simple static stretches target key muscle groups, helping to relieve tension. These should be performed after rides or on active recovery days to maintain circulation and prevent stiffness.

Recovery rides are another excellent option. They involve cycling at a low intensity for a short duration, typically 30–60 minutes. This should be done on flat terrain, allowing muscles to recover while avoiding strain. Incorporating these into a weekly schedule can enhance overall recovery.

The Necessity of Rest Days and Recovery Weeks

Scheduled rest days are essential for recovery. They provide the body time to repair muscles and replenish energy stores. A general guideline is to take at least one full rest day per week, particularly after intense training sessions.

Recovery weeks should also be considered. These involve reduced training intensity and volume, allowing the body to adapt to the stresses of the previous weeks’ training. This strategy can prevent burnout and minimise the risk of overtraining while enhancing performance in subsequent workouts.

Swimming and Other Low-Impact Activities

Swimming is an effective low-impact recovery activity. It engages multiple muscle groups and can help with circulation without putting stress on joints. A session in the pool can complement cycling efforts and assist with recovery, especially if muscle soreness is present.

Other low-impact options include walking, elliptical training, or rowing. These activities maintain fitness levels while promoting recovery. Integrating these into a regular routine will help cyclists recover efficiently, preparing them for future training sessions.

Utilising Compression Gear for Enhanced Circulation

Compression clothing, such as socks and sleeves, aids in improving blood circulation. These garments apply graduated pressure to the muscles, which helps reduce swelling and enhances venous return. Professional riders often incorporate compression socks during rides and recovery periods.

Studies suggest that wearing compression gear may decrease muscle soreness and fatigue by promoting faster removal of metabolic waste from the muscles. Incorporating these into post-ride routines can lead to quicker recovery times. Riders should choose compression levels suited to their needs, typically ranging from 15-30 mmHg.

Implementing Cool Down Practices to Reduce Fatigue

A proper cool down is crucial after a long bike ride. Gradually lowering the heart rate through light cycling in Zone 1 for 10-15 minutes allows the body to transition from intense activity to rest. This practice aids in flushing out lactic acid and reducing muscle stiffness.

Stretching exercises post-ride also play a vital role in recovery. Focusing on major muscle groups, such as the hamstrings, quads, and calves, can enhance flexibility and further alleviate tension. Additionally, integrating hydration with electrolytes and complex carbohydrates supports nutrient replenishment and aids in preventing dehydration.

The Role of Antioxidants and the Immune System

Antioxidants are essential for combating oxidative stress, which can occur after prolonged cycling sessions. Foods rich in antioxidants, such as berries, nuts, and leafy greens, can help mitigate inflammation and support the immune system. This consideration is critical for cyclists who train intensively.

Maintaining a strong immune system is important for cyclists, as intense training can weaken immunity. Including a balanced diet with appropriate vitamins and minerals can help maintain performance levels while ensuring faster recovery. Further, staying hydrated pre- and post-ride is vital for overall health and efficient recovery.
